Moonbounce Secures $12M to Deliver Real-Time Governance of AI Systems

New AI Control Engine Enables Real-Time Policy Enforcement, Reducing Risk and Ensuring Consistent Behavior Across High-Scale Generative Systems

Moonbounce has officially emerged from stealth with $12 million in funding, introducing a new approach to managing and governing artificial intelligence systems in real time. As organizations increasingly deploy generative AI across customer-facing and operational workflows, the challenge of ensuring consistent, policy-aligned behavior has become a critical concern. Moonbounce positions itself as a solution to this problem by offering a control engine that enables organizations to enforce precise behavioral rules at the exact moment decisions are made.

The funding round was led by Amplify Partners and StepStone Group, with additional participation from angel investors including PrimeSet and Josh Leslie, the former CEO of Cumulus Networks and Gremlin. This strong backing reflects growing investor confidence in the importance of AI governance infrastructure as a foundational layer for modern digital systems.

The platform has already demonstrated significant traction across multiple industries. It is currently being used by customers operating in domains such as online dating platforms, AI chat applications, and generative content ecosystems. Notable adopters include Civitai and Dippy, both of which require robust moderation and control mechanisms to manage large volumes of user-generated and AI-generated content.

Moonbounce’s scale of operation underscores the growing demand for such solutions. The platform has processed more than one trillion tokens and serves a combined user base of approximately 250 million monthly active users. On a daily basis, it evaluates around 50 million pieces of content, demonstrating its ability to operate at the scale required by modern AI-driven platforms. This level of throughput highlights the importance of automation and real-time processing in maintaining system integrity and compliance.

The company’s leadership team brings deep expertise in large-scale technology systems and AI governance. Brett Levenson previously led the Integrity unit at Meta, where he was responsible for overseeing content moderation and platform safety initiatives. His experience in managing complex, high-stakes environments informs Moonbounce’s focus on reliability and precision. Co-founder and CTO Ash Bhardwaj brings a strong engineering background from Apple, where he worked on large-scale cloud and AI infrastructure. In addition to its core production platform, Moonbounce offers a development environment known as the Playground. This sandboxed tool allows teams to design, test, and refine policy logic before deploying it into live systems. By simulating real-world scenarios and exploring edge cases, organizations can gain a deeper understanding of how their policies will perform under different conditions. This capability not only reduces the risk of unintended consequences but also accelerates the development process by enabling rapid iteration and validation.
